Approximately 1 km away
Address: 306,Mazda Showroom, Plot2, Block Dubai International airport 2 - PO. 234255 ,Galadari Building - Dubai - United Arab Emirates
Approximately 1.46 km away
Address: PO Box 232159,Suite#108, Al Qusais-1, - Mai Tower.Al Nahda-1,Near NMC Sepeciality Hospital - Dubai - United Arab Emirates